What Is Sauce Labs? Sauce Labs Documentation

This workflow is responsible for approving or rejecting detected changes between a snapshot and a baseline.Users might be out there to evaluate changes and make the baseline evolve for accepted adjustments https://www.globalcloudteam.com/. Browse the safety documentation to learn how to talk with Sauce Labs Cloud out of your non-public community. Streamline Android/ iOS app distribution and management with our secure, all-in-one platform.

Parallel Testing With Sauce Labs

Customer Service and Email Marketing groups also benefit from Sauce Labs, using it to identify and tackle customer points and bugs before or after deployment. Additionally, the QA team depends on Sauce Labs for executing daily automation take a look at circumstances on various platforms together with cell and net. Sauce Labs has proved to be a priceless what is sauce labs software for various teams and departments within organizations. Users recognize the seamless integration of the platform with Jenkins CI servers, enabling continuous testing of web purposes in real browsers and Dockerized environments. The capability to simply configure proxy tunnels and access firewalled environments and desired browsers through the Sauce OnDemand Jenkins plugin has been a significant selling level. Sauce Bindings provide you with a wrapper — or binding — for our platform’s hottest programming languages, permitting you to join with Sauce Labs out of your take a look at framework to carry out automated internet and cell app testing.

Webdriverio + Appium + Sauce Labs = Success? – Reside Stream

What is Sauce Labs used for

Sauce Labs is a cloud-based platformfor automated testing of desktop and cellular purposes. It is designed to be immediately scalable, since it is optimized for continuousintegration workflows. According to the vendor, this mix permits developers to easilytest desktop and hybrid, native and cellular net applications early on in theirdevelopment cycles, continuously and affordably.

What is Sauce Labs used for

Finding The Right Sauce Labs Alternative On Your Needs

What is Sauce Labs used for

Once the take a look at script accesses the web page to check, it wants to find the weather that an finish user would work together with. Remote WebDriver lessons are instantiated with the URL of the server or service you want in your checks. Below you can see links to our quickstart guides and demo repos, listed by framework, and code samples listed by language. Note that not all properties are uncovered on all testing frameworks.In these instances, a default value (0, null or empty string) is used. Browse the continual integration and steady supply documentation to explore tips on how to combine Sauce Labs into your DevOps pipeline. Browse via the Automated Testing documentation to see examples of how to run tests in your most popular automation framework.

What is Sauce Labs used for

Automated Testing & Error Monitoring Solutions

We have rated parameters like reliability, system protection and assist availability with a “High” importance for Sauce Labs alternatives given they immediately impression the efficiency of your every day testing actions. In one year, Walmart saved 750,000+ people hours that would have been spent on guide testing/updating support for brand new browsers and working methods. Scaling up checks requires at a minimal a test runner, and even better a extra fully featured testing library. These tools allow for higher abstractions and fewer code duplication in your tests, in addition to the flexibility to run tests in parallel instead of simply sequentially. When Selenium executes a find factor call and the motive force cannot discover the element, an exception is thrown immediately.An implicit wait is about telling the driving force how lengthy to wait before throwing the exception.If the element is positioned right away, the value of the implicit wait doesn’t matter.

  • The matching course of happens as part of the snapshot creation (createSnapshot in the API).This means, that a baseline can solely be thought of for a diff if it existed before the createSnapshot call.
  • Create an instance of Selenium’s Remote WebDriver class so you’ll find a way to invoke methods of the Selenium WebDriver API on Sauce Labs infrastructure.
  • Regardless of the language, changing the strategy name from “element” to “elements” will search the whole DOM, and return a collection of all matching parts somewhat than just the primary one.
  • Sauce Bindings give you a wrapper — or binding — for our platform’s hottest programming languages, allowing you to join with Sauce Labs from your test framework to carry out automated web and cell app testing.
  • Whether it’s the code we write, the software program we use, or the platform providers we provide, safety is all the time extremely essential.

Sauce Labs Is A Superb Cellular Testing Platfor , However It Could Be Too Expensive For Smaller Organizations

To discover an element, cross your locator methodology as an argument of a WebDriver API finder technique. BrowserStack is a longstanding software centered explicitly on browser compatibility and performance testing. Cost-per-minute pricing allows versatile utilization without costly annual commitments. E.g. to have the power to view all snapshots taken during the execution of your check suite in CI or domestically. Know exactly the place and what has changed so as to ship a constant and intuitive person experience. Browse via the Live Testing documentation to manually check your app on Sauce Labs Cloud.

We present the instruments you should get began shortly with Sauce Labs utilizing your favorite framework. With open supply know-how and Sauce Labs, Verizon Media improved high quality, elevated efficiency, and decreased staffing, hardware, and upkeep costs.

What is Sauce Labs used for

Overall, users highly suggest Sauce Labs as a prime service provider out there, particularly for continuous automated testing and serious cellular or desktop testing. It is praised for its secure nature and integration with actual gadgets on the cloud. However, users also recommend attempting other services like BrowserStack for comparability functions.

It has turn into a quantity one resolution for automated and handbook testing throughout totally different browsers, gadgets and working systems. However, frequent technical points like take a look at failures, lack of device coverage can hinder adoption for some groups. One key use case for Sauce Labs is operating regression take a look at suites towards totally different OS and browser combos, which saves effort and time in maintaining test environments. Developer groups make the most of Sauce Labs for working end-to-end Selenium tests, whereas the testing team manages its usage across the organization.

If you are in a bind, and need to try an implicit wait, make it a small value, set it with the Browser Options when creating the session, after which don’t change it. Perfecto Mobile offers highly dependable and safe cell net / app testing obtainable solely by way of the AWS cloud. AWS Device Farm suits startups open to cloud-native solutions all the way to massive enterprises already on AWS. Smooth integration with the CI/CD pipeline makes it appropriate for agile teams working towards steady supply. Mapping these components to the options above will help zero-in on the closest match to exchange Sauce Labs effectively. Reaching out for hands-on tailor-made steerage from vendor resolution architects can additional help in evaluating products.

LEAVE A REPLY